What Is Composite Bonding?

Composite Bonding Middlesbrough is a cosmetic dental procedure that uses a tooth-colored resin material to repair or enhance the appearance of your teeth. Unlike traditional veneers or crowns, which require significant tooth preparation, bonding is a conservative treatment that preserves your natural tooth structure.

How Does It Work?

The process involves applying a special resin, a durable blend of plastic and fine glass particles, to the surface of your tooth. The dentist then shapes, molds, and hardens the material using a high-intensity light, creating a seamless, natural-looking finish. Because the resin is carefully matched to your existing teeth, the results blend in effortlessly.

What Can Composite Bonding Fix?

 

Composite Bonding Middlesbrough is a versatile treatment that addresses a wide range of common dental concerns. If you’ve ever felt self-conscious about any of the following, bonding could be the solution you’ve been looking for:

1. Chipped or Cracked Teeth

Accidents happen, whether it’s a sports injury, a fall, or simply biting down on something hard. A chipped tooth can be unsightly and may even affect your bite. Composite Bonding Middlesbrough can restore the shape and strength of your tooth, making it look as good as new.

2. Gaps Between Teeth

Small gaps (known as diastemas) can make some people feel insecure about their smile. While braces are an option, Composite Bonding Middlesbrough provides a quicker, more affordable way to close minor spaces. The resin is applied to the sides of your teeth, filling in the gap for a more uniform appearance.

3. Stains and Discoloration

Teeth whitening works well for surface stains, but some discoloration, such as that caused by medications, trauma, or aging, doesn’t respond to bleaching. Composite Bonding Middlesbrough can cover these stubborn stains, giving you a brighter, more consistent smile.

4. Misshapen or Uneven Teeth

Some people are born with teeth that are naturally uneven, too short, or oddly shaped. Bonding allows your dentist to reshape your teeth, creating a more balanced, symmetrical smile. Whether you want to lengthen a tooth or smooth out rough edges, the resin can be sculpted to achieve your desired look.

5. Worn-Down Teeth

Over time, teeth can wear down due to grinding (bruxism), aging, or acidic foods. This can lead to a flattened, aged appearance. Composite Bonding Middlesbrough can restore the natural contours of your teeth, making them look fuller and more youthful.

6. Minor Misalignment

If your teeth are slightly crooked but you don’t want to commit to braces, bonding can be a great alternative. While it won’t replace orthodontic treatment for severe alignment issues, it can effectively mask minor irregularities, giving you a straighter-looking smile in just one visit.

Step 3: Shade Selection

Achieving a natural look is crucial. Your dentist will work with you to select a resin shade that matches your existing teeth. If you’re undergoing a full smile makeover, you can choose from a range of shades, from a natural white to a brighter, more dramatic tone.

Pro Tip: If you’re considering teeth whitening, it’s best to complete this before your bonding treatment. Since the resin doesn’t respond to whitening gels, matching it to whitened teeth ensures a uniform appearance.

Step 4: Tooth Preparation

Unlike veneers, Composite Bonding Middlesbrough requires minimal preparation. Your dentist will:

  • Clean the surface of your tooth.
  • Apply a mild etching gel to create microscopic pores, helping the resin adhere securely.
  • Apply a bonding agent to ensure a strong connection between the resin and your tooth.

Step 5: Resin Application and Sculpting

This is where the artistry comes in. Your dentist will:

  • Apply the resin in a putty-like form to the targeted area.
  • Mold and shape the material by hand to achieve the desired contour.
  • Ensure the bonding blends seamlessly with your natural teeth.

Step 6: Curing and Polishing

Once the perfect shape is achieved:

  • A specialized curing light is used to harden the resin in seconds.
  • Your dentist will refine the restoration, removing any excess material.
  • The bonding is polished to a smooth, natural shine, mimicking the translucency of real enamel.

Step 7: Final Review

Before you leave, your dentist will:

  • Check your bite to ensure comfort.
  • Review the aesthetic results with you.
  • Provide aftercare instructions to help maintain your new smile.

The entire process for Composite Bonding Middlesbrough is typically completed in one to two hours, depending on the number of teeth being treated.

Who Is a Good Candidate for Composite Bonding?

While Composite Bonding Middlesbrough is a versatile treatment, it’s not suitable for everyone. Here’s how to determine if you’re a good candidate:

Ideal Candidates Include Those Who:

  • Have healthy teeth and gums (no active decay or gum disease).
  • Want to address minor cosmetic issues like chips, gaps, stains, or misshapen teeth.
  • Have no more than a quarter of a tooth missing (for durability).
  • Prefer a non-invasive, quick solution over more extensive treatments.

May Not Be Suitable For:

  • Severe structural damage (such as large cracks or extensive decay).
  • Complex bite issues (orthodontic treatment may be needed first).
  • Patients with poor oral hygiene (bonding requires good maintenance to last).

Aftercare: How to Make Your Composite Bonding Last

To get the most out of your Composite Bonding Middlesbrough treatment, proper aftercare is essential. Here’s how to keep your new smile looking its best:

Daily Oral Hygiene

  • Brush twice a day with a soft-bristled toothbrush and non-abrasive fluoride toothpaste.
  • Floss daily to prevent plaque buildup around the bonding.
  • Use an antimicrobial mouthwash to keep your gums healthy.

Avoid: Whitening toothpastes, as they can dull the resin over time.

Habits to Avoid

Composite resin is strong, but it’s not as tough as natural enamel. To prevent damage:

  • Don’t bite your nails, pens, or other hard objects.
  • Avoid using your teeth as tools (e.g., opening bottles or tearing packaging).
  • Steer clear of hard foods like ice, hard candies, or popcorn kernels.
  • Limit sticky foods (caramel, toffee) that can pull at the bonding.

Staining Prevention

The resin used in Composite Bonding Middlesbrough can absorb pigments over time. To minimize staining:

  • Avoid coffee, tea, red wine, and tobacco for the first 48 hours after treatment.
  • Rinse your mouth with water after consuming dark-colored foods or drinks.
  • Consider using a straw for beverages that may stain.

Regular Dental Check-Ups

  • Visit your dentist every 6 months for a check-up and professional cleaning.
  • Your dentist can polish the bonding to restore its shine if needed.
  • If you notice chipping, rough edges, or discoloration, schedule a repair appointment promptly.

Nighttime Protection

If you grind or clench your teeth (a condition called bruxism), ask your dentist about a custom night guard. This will protect your bonding from unnecessary wear and tear.

With proper care, Composite Bonding Middlesbrough can maintain its beauty and function for 5 to 10 years or longer.

Common Questions About Composite Bonding Middlesbrough

Q1. Does Composite Bonding Hurt?

Ans: No. The procedure is pain-free for most patients. Since minimal tooth preparation is involved, anesthesia is rarely required.

Q2. How Long Does Composite Bonding Last?

Ans: With good oral hygiene and regular dental visits, Composite Bonding Middlesbrough typically lasts 5 to 10 years. Touch-ups or repairs may be needed over time.

Q3. Can Composite Bonding Be Whitened?

Ans: No. Unlike natural teeth, the resin does not respond to whitening treatments. If you want a brighter smile, it’s best to whiten your natural teeth first before getting bonding.

Q4. Is Composite Bonding Reversible?

Ans: Yes. Since very little (if any) enamel is removed, Composite Bonding Middlesbrough is generally reversible. However, if you later opt for veneers or crowns, some tooth preparation may be needed.

Q5. How Does Composite Bonding Compare to Veneers?

  • Composite Bonding: Quick, affordable, minimally invasive, but less durable (5-10 years).
  • Veneers: More durable (10-15+ years), but require enamel removal and are more expensive.

Q6. Can Composite Bonding Fix Crooked Teeth?

Ans: It can mask minor misalignment, but for significant crookedness, orthodontic treatment (like Invisalign) may be a better long-term solution.

Q7. What Should I Eat After Composite Bonding?

Ans: For the first 24-48 hours, stick to soft foods (soup, yogurt, mashed potatoes) and avoid hard, sticky, or staining foods/drinks. After that, you can resume a normal diet with caution.

Q8. Does Composite Bonding Require Special Care?

Ans: Not really, just good oral hygiene (brushing, flossing, regular check-ups) and avoiding habits that can damage the resin (like nail-biting or chewing ice).
